The Role

  • As Sales Manager, you will be responsible for driving the performance of the sales department while maintaining exceptional customer standards.
  • Key responsibilities include:
    • Leading, motivating, and developing a high-performing sales team
    • Driving vehicle sales, finance, insurance, and add-on products
    • Managing day-to-day sales operations and departmental KPIs
    • Ensuring compliance with FCA and company standards
    • Delivering an outstanding customer experience at every stage of the sales journey

The Ideal Candidate

  • Proven experience in an automotive sales management role
  • Strong leadership, coaching, and performance management skills
  • Commercially focused with a passion for customer service
  • Confident managing finance and compliance processes
  • Professional, driven, and results-oriented

How to prepare for a job interview at The Solution Automotive Limited

Know Your Numbers

As a Sales Manager, you'll need to demonstrate your understanding of sales metrics and KPIs. Brush up on your previous sales figures, conversion rates, and any relevant financial data. Being able to discuss these confidently will show that you're commercially focused and results-oriented.

Showcase Your Leadership Skills

Prepare examples of how you've led and motivated a sales team in the past. Think about specific challenges you faced and how you overcame them. This will highlight your strong leadership and coaching abilities, which are crucial for this role.

Understand Customer Experience

Since delivering an outstanding customer experience is key, be ready to discuss how you've ensured high standards in previous roles. Share stories that illustrate your passion for customer service and how it positively impacted sales.

Familiarise Yourself with Compliance

Make sure you understand FCA regulations and compliance processes relevant to the automotive industry. Being able to speak knowledgeably about these topics will demonstrate your professionalism and confidence in managing finance and compliance.
